Basement Drainage Installation in West Des Moines, IA

Basement drainage installation services focus on creating effective systems to manage excess water and prevent flooding or moisture buildup inside a home’s basement. These projects typically involve installing drainage pipes, sump pumps, and waterproof barriers designed to direct water away from the foundation, helping to maintain a dry and stable basement environment. Property owners often seek this service when experiencing recurring dampness, water seepage, or flooding issues, especially after heavy rains or rapid snowmelt, to protect their property’s structural integrity and prevent mold growth.

Before requesting basement drainage installation,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including what areas will be affected and how the system will be integrated with existing foundation features. It’s also common to inquire about the materials used, the expected lifespan of the system, and any necessary preparations or modifications to the property.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the drainage system effectively addresses specific water management needs and provides long-term peace of mind.

FAQ

Basement Drainage Installation Questions

What is basement drainage installation? It involves adding systems to direct excess water away from the basement to prevent flooding and water damage.

Why is proper drainage important for basements? Effective drainage helps keep basements dry, reduces mold growth, and protects the foundation from water-related issues.

What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common options include interior drain tiles, exterior footing drains, and sump pump systems to manage water flow.

How can property owners prepare for drainage installation? Clearing the area around the basement and addressing any existing water issues can help ensure a smooth installation process.
